
Cytogenetics Technologist
Legacy Health is looking for an experienced, passionate, and driven Cytogenetics Technologist to join our team. As a Cytogenetics Technologist, you will have the opportunity to work with the latest technology and techniques to identify genetic abnormalities in our patients. You will be responsible for specimen collection, analysis, and interpretation of results while providing excellent patient care. To be successful in this role, you must have a Bachelor's degree in Medical Technology, Cytogenetics or a closely related field and be eligible for certification by the American Society of Clinical Pathologists (ASCP). You must have a minimum of two years of experience in a clinical laboratory setting and working knowledge of laboratory information systems. You must also have excellent communication and organizational skills and the ability to work effectively in a team environment. Additionally, the ideal candidate should have strong attention to detail and the 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ously.

Legacy Health is a non-profit hospital system located in Portland, Oregon, United States. It consists of six primary-care hospitals, a children's hospital, and allied clinics and outpatient facilities. The system employs about 14,000 staff members, and is the second-largest system in the Portland metro area, after the Providence Health System.
